Why is the World Cup delayed so long this year?

Qatar-Ecuador ended at 100 feet. England-Iran it didn’t last long 117 feet 16 inches. Hours in Senegal-Netherlands He wrote 102:49 while USA-Wales in turn touched him 104:34.

If it wasn’t already clear the delay time in the World Cup this year is long. Sometimes very long, as in some matches so far it has exceeded 10 minutes, and sometimes almost touched the quarter.

Surely many were dumbfounded by this, and others were quick to do the right thing on Twitter.

They were not mistaken: according to Opta, the 5 longest halves in World Cup history were recorded on Monday and Tuesday.

We say so: First half England-Iran: 13’59”. Second half Argentina-Saudi Arabia: 13’53”. Second half England-Iran: 13’05”. Second half USA-Wales: 10’32”. Second half Senegal-Netherlands: 10’03”.

However, the answer to the question of why the matches of the World Cup this year are so long delayed has already been given by the president of the FIFA referees. Pierluigi Collina.

So, as Colina confirmed last week, the fourth judges have received clear instructions. carefully record the time lost during the game this is due to VAR, possible injuries, penalties, red cards and other game procedures that he has already tried to implement since the World Cup. in Russia in 2018.

“In Russia, we tried to more accurately compensate for the lost time during the games, and because of this you saw six, seven or even eight minutes of delay,” Kolina explained.

“Think about it,” he says. “If you score three goals in half, probably four or five minutes will be lost to the celebration.”

So get ready for long delays in the following matches of Qatar and do not leave the game ahead of time: after all, Medi Taremi scored for Iran at 102:30 in the England-Iran match.
